Storm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small sink overflow on tile floor Yes No You can likely handle a small water spill on your own with some towels and a mop.
Flooded basement with standing water No Yes Standing water in your basement can lead to mold growth and structural damage, it’s best to call a professional.
Wet drywall behind cabinets No Yes Water damage behind walls can be hidden and lead to further damage if not addressed properly, call a pro for safe and effective restoration.
Summer storm damage to roof No Yes Summer storms can cause significant damage to your roof, call a professional to assess and repair any damage.
Spring flooding in your yard No Yes Spring flooding can cause significant damage to your yard and home, call a pro to handle the cleanup and restoration.
Winter freeze damage to pipes No Yes Winter freeze damage to pipes can be costly and time-consuming to repair, call a pro to assess and fix the issue.

Storm Damage Restoration Cost In The 84134 Area

The cost of storm damage restoration in the 84134 area can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on industry standards and may not reflect the actual cost of your restoration project. Get a free estimate to find out the cost of your specific project.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ed
Structural Drying Process $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, equipment needed, and duration of drying process
Mold Inspection and Testing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, complexity of mold growth, and equipment needed
Sewage Cleanup $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, amount of sewage, and equipment needed
Basement Flood Recovery $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ed
Post-Remediation Verification $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, complexity of restoration, and equipment needed
